[0010] At present, the maximum paging cycle will not exceed the maximum length of the SFN. In practice, especially for MTC terminals that communicate with the network occasionally, even if the maximum DRX cycle is used, it will appear too frequent, which is not conducive to the terminal's power saving.

Embodiment 1

[0056] Embodiment 1: Determination of paging time in LTE system. Such as Figure 5 shown, including the following steps:

[0057] S301. The network side broadcasts and sends system information SIB16, which includes GPS (Global Positioning System, Global Positioning System) time information;

[0058] S302. The network side allocates configuration information referring to GPS time according to the conditions of the accessed terminal, including: specifying the wireless frame at GPS time T1 to initiate paging, the cheap S in the wireless frame, and the paging cycle P, The paging cycle is an integer multiple of the GPS time granularity.

[0059] S303. The network side and the terminal determine the paging time T1+N*P+S; wherein, N=an integer of 0, 1, 2....

Embodiment 2

[0060] Embodiment 2: UMTS system improvement.

[0061] For the UMTS system, since the current network time is only given in the message of MBMS (Multimedia Broadcast Multicast Service, Multimedia Broadcast Multicast Service), and only the LCR TDD mode is used, other modes cannot obtain the system time. Therefore, the LTE method can be similarly used to newly define a system information block (SIB) to carry system time information.

[0062] Similar to Embodiment 1, the terminal calculates the paging location based on configuration information based on system time information.

Embodiment 3

[0063] Embodiment 3: An application scheme for transmission of an internal interface on the network side.

[0064] The network side is actually composed of two layers of equipment, the core network and the access network. The core network manages the paging configuration, and the access network sends paging messages according to the signaling of the core network. When the network needs to page a certain UE, the CN node of the core network sends a paging message to the base station eNB or the network controller RNC, in which in addition to the identity of the UE and the content of the paging message, detailed paging time information is also provided to the receiving terminal. Incoming side. For example, a specific GPS time can be specified each time, and the access network node sends a paging message at the specified GPS time position. Abstract

The embodiment of the invention provides a network side paging method and device and a terminal paging method and device. According to the invention, a paging period is prevented from being limited by a system frame number (SFN), and a terminal is configured to have a relatively long paging period, so that the power consumption of the terminal is reduced. The method comprises the steps of determining the current time to be a transmission time of a paging message, wherein the transmission time of the paging message is determined by negotiation with the terminal by using a standard time in advance; and transmitting the paging message to the terminal.

technical field [0001] The present invention relates to the field of mobile communication, in particular to a network side and terminal paging method and device. Background technique [0002] For the wireless network side, in the LTE (Long Term Evolution, long-term evolution) system, the terminal has two states, namely RRC_connected (connected) state and RRC-idle (idle) state; in UMTS (Universal Mobile Telecommunication System, universal mobile Communication system), the terminal has five states, namely cell-dch, cell_fach, cell_pch / ura_pch and idle (idle) state. Among them, cell-dch, cell_fach, and cell_pch / ura_pch all belong to the RRC_connected (connected) state, and the terminal can only send uplink data after entering the RRC_connected state.
